Greenville homes, from historic to brand-new
Greenville County’s housing runs from century-old homes in older neighborhoods to large volumes of recent construction in the suburbs. Older homes warrant a close look at original systems and past repairs; newer homes benefit from construction and pre-drywall inspections.
Radon testing is available as an add-on, since radon is naturally present across the Upstate.
